Selective avoidance of Ukraine information was highest in most of the countries closest to the conflict, enhancing searchings for from our added survey last year, not long after the war had started. Our information might not recommend an absence of passion in Ukraine from close-by nations but rather a desire to handle time or safeguard mental health from the really genuine scaries of battle.
Comparing Finland with a politically polarised nation such as the USA (see following chart) that is less influenced by the war, we find an extremely various pattern of subject evasion. In the United States, we discover that customers are more probable to stay clear of subjects such as nationwide politics and social justice, where disputes over issues such as sex, sexuality, and race have actually become very politicised.
American politics are pretty harmful these days. I locate occasionally that I need to detach from tales that simply make me angry. F, 61, USA For some people, bitter and divisive political disputes are a reason to shut off news altogether, however, for some political upholders, avoidance is often concerning shutting out viewpoints you don't intend to hear.

Across markets, general rely on news (40%) and depend on in the resources people use themselves (46%) are down by an additionally 2 portion points this year.
Via the rear-view mirror, the COVID-19 count on bump is clearly noticeable in the complying with graph, though the instructions of travel later on has actually been mixed. In some cases (e.g. Finland), the trust increase has actually been kept, while in others the upturn looks more like a spot in a tale of continued long-lasting decrease.
A few of the highest reported degrees of media objection are located in nations with highest possible degrees of question, such as Greece, the Philippines, the USA, France, and the United Kingdom. The most affordable levels of media criticism frequent those with Home Page higher levels of depend on, such as Finland, Norway, Denmark, and Japan.

This year we asked respondents concerning their preferences for text, audio and video clip when eating information online. Typically, we discover that the bulk still prefer to check out the news (57%), as opposed to watch (30%) or pay attention to it (13%), but more youthful people (under-35s) are more probable to listen (17%) than older groups.
Behind the standards we discover substantial and surprising country differences. In markets with a strong analysis tradition, such as Finland and the UK, around eight in ten still like to go check out online news, but in India and Thailand, around 4 in 10 (40%) state they favor to enjoy news online, and in the Philippines that percentage mores than fifty percent (52%).
